Home / Royal Mail (page 3271)

Royal Mail

Panic buying but no food shortages in the UK

Any one who has been shopping this weekend will probably have been greeted by empty shelves as panic buying gripped the country with the most popular product to be stock piled being toilet roll. Shelves were emptied as soon as stocks were replenished and seeing the empty shelves just made …

Read More »